Dreibruken – the Continental Modeller article
Our Swiss layout, Dreibruken was donated to the club, and already 25 years old when we took her over. ESNG completely renovated the layout, and Dreibrucken has been a firm exhibition favourite. Unfortunately, the old lady is now a bit past … Continue reading
